Facing Catastrophic Events: Common Challenges and Solutions

Responding to catastrophic events presents a myriad of formidable challenges. Funding limitations can hinder effective disaster preparedness and response efforts. Collaboration between various agencies and organizations can become strained, leading to delays in relief operations. The extent of damage often overwhelms local infrastructure, exacerbating the humanitarian crisis.

  • To mitigate these challenges, comprehensive disaster planning strategies are crucial. This includes investing sufficient resources for preparedness measures and emergency response systems.
  • Establishing robust liaison networks between government agencies, NGOs, and communities can facilitate a timely and coordinated response.
  • Investing in resilient infrastructure, such as early warning systems and flood-control measures, can help minimize the impact of catastrophic events.

By addressing these challenges head-on, we can strive to build more sustainable communities capable of withstanding the hardships posed website by catastrophic events.

Navigating Post-Disaster Recovery: Essential Steps and Resources

Recovering from a disaster can be overwhelming, challenging both physically and emotionally. To begin the journey effectively, it's crucial to take prompt action and access available support. First, prioritize your safety and the well-being of your loved ones. Secure your property and avoid hazardous areas.

Contact local authorities and emergency services to report any injuries, destruction and request assistance. A emergency plan can help you coordinate your response and reduce the impact of the disaster.

Once immediate needs are addressed, focus on critical tasks like repairing basic infrastructure. This may involve contacting your insurance provider and documenting the destruction for reimbursement.

Leverage available community resources, such as food banks, shelters, and financial aid programs. Connect with neighbors and your circle for emotional strength.

Remember that recovery is a continuous journey. Be patient with yourself, seek support when needed, and focus on rebuilding your community.
